T he 1950s were a time of profound change and contrast, both in American society and globally. These complexities were captured in the period's photography, from celebrity snaps by the burgeoning paparazzi to powerful images of the Civil Rights Movement taken by experienced photojournalists. Here are six photos that encapsulate the spirit and struggles of the decade, and have become iconic images of the 1950s.
